If you’ve been on a quest for personal development, it’s likely that you’ve come across the name Nicole LePera. With her book “How to Do the Work”, she has captivated readers worldwide by sharing her insights and practical strategies for healing and self-growth. As a licensed psychologist and social media sensation, LePera’s approach to mental well-being has garnered a significant following and praise from many.

In “How to Do the Work,” LePera delves into themes such as trauma, emotional healing, and self-awareness, providing readers with a roadmap to transforming their lives. She emphasizes the importance of taking responsibility for our actions, owning our stories, and utilizing practical tools to break through limiting patterns. With LePera’s guidance, readers are encouraged to embrace discomfort, confront their shadows, and heal from within.

LePera’s work is rooted in a blend of psychology, holistic healing modalities, and mindfulness practices. Through her book, she encourages individuals to tap into the power of their minds and bodies, fostering a deeper understanding of the mind-body connection. By combining aspects of science and spirituality, LePera offers a holistic approach to self-growth that goes beyond traditional therapy and brings personal transformation to the forefront.

1. Understanding the Work

LePera introduces the concept of “the work,” which refers to the inner exploration and healing necessary to create lasting change. She emphasizes the importance of understanding the connection between mind, body, and spirit, and how they influence our thoughts, emotions, and behaviors.

In this first part of the book, LePera explores the impact of childhood experiences and early conditioning on our current patterns and beliefs. By becoming aware of these ingrained patterns, readers can begin to take responsibility for their own healing.

2. Practicing Radical Acceptance

LePera highlights the significance of radical acceptance as the foundation for personal growth. It involves acknowledging and embracing all parts of ourselves, including our shadow aspects and past wounds. Through self-compassion and acceptance, we can begin to release shame and guilt, allowing for transformation and healing to take place.

The author encourages readers to cultivate self-awareness practices like journaling, meditation, and mindfulness to deepen their understanding of their thoughts, emotions, and behaviors. These practices facilitate the exploration of limiting beliefs and patterns, promoting personal evolution.

3. Challenging and Replacing Limiting Beliefs

In this section, LePera guides readers on how to identify and challenge their limiting beliefs. She provides practical exercises and reflection questions to assist in uncovering these beliefs that may be holding us back in different areas of our lives.

LePera offers strategies for replacing limiting beliefs with empowering ones, highlighting the power of affirmations and visualization techniques. By reframing our thoughts, we can create new neural pathways that align with our desired outcomes.

Understanding the philosophy

In her book “How to Do the Work”, Nicole LePera introduces a unique approach to personal development and healing. She emphasizes the importance of understanding and addressing the root causes of our emotional and physical struggles, rather than just treating the symptoms.

LePera believes that true healing can only occur when we delve deep into our past experiences and traumas, acknowledging and releasing any unresolved emotions and negative patterns. This involves taking responsibility for our own healing journey and developing a sense of self-empowerment.

The philosophy presented in “How to Do the Work” is grounded in several key principles:

  1. Self-awareness: LePera encourages individuals to cultivate a deep understanding of their emotions, reactions, and behaviors. By identifying the patterns and triggers that contribute to their struggles, they can begin to make conscious choices and embrace personal growth.
  2. Radical responsibility: Taking ownership of our actions, thoughts, and emotions is crucial in the healing process. LePera highlights the importance of not blaming others or external circumstances, but rather focusing on our internal world and how we respond to external factors.
  3. Compassion: LePera emphasizes the need to approach ourselves and others with compassion, kindness, and empathy. Understanding that everyone is on their own unique journey allows for greater acceptance and understanding.
  4. Integrative healing: Instead of relying solely on one approach or modality, LePera encourages individuals to explore a range of holistic practices such as therapy, nutrition, mindfulness, movement, and creative expression. By integrating these practices into their daily lives, individuals can create a supportive and sustainable healing environment.

Overall, the philosophy presented by Nicole LePera in “How to Do the Work” emphasizes the importance of self-awareness, personal responsibility, compassion, and integrative healing. By adopting this philosophy and implementing the suggested practices, individuals can embark on a transformative journey of self-discovery, healing, and growth.

1. Self-reflection

Start by dedicating some time each day to self-reflection. Take a few moments to sit quietly, close your eyes, and turn your attention inward. Ask yourself how you’re feeling, what thoughts are coming up, and if there are any patterns or behaviors you’ve been noticing. This process of introspection will help you become more aware of your emotions and thoughts, allowing you to identify areas that need work.

2. Understanding triggers

Once you’ve established a baseline for self-reflection, pay attention to the triggers in your life. Triggers are events, situations, or even people who bring up intense emotions or negative reactions. By identifying your triggers, you can gain insight into why certain situations affect you in a particular way. This awareness will enable you to consciously respond rather than impulsively react, facilitating personal growth and healing.

Example: If you notice that you become defensive and angry when receiving feedback, explore the reasons behind this reaction. Perhaps it reminds you of past criticism or taps into feelings of insecurity.

3. Practicing self-compassion

While doing the work can sometimes be challenging, remind yourself to approach it with compassion. Healing is a journey that requires patience, kindness, and support. Treat yourself with the same care and understanding you would extend to a close friend or loved one. Be gentle and forgiving, allowing for setbacks and understanding that each step forward brings you closer to wholeness.
